LRT-1 holiday schedule for December 24, 31, 2021

LRT-1 private operator Light Rail Manila Corporation (LRMC) announced that they would be implementing shortened holiday schedule on December 24 (Chrismas Eve) and December 31 (New Year’s Eve).

The last trip from Baclaran Station will leave at 8:00 PM on December 24, 2021, while the last train from Balintawak Station will leave at 8:15 PM as opposed to the weekend/holiday schedules it has set prior.

On December 31, 2021, Baclaran Station’s last trip will be at 7:00 PM, and the last train from the North Side, Balintawak Station, will leave at 7:15 PM. On the other hand, the first train set out from both ends of the train line will be at 4:30 AM.

LRT-1 will be Business As Usual on December 25, 2021 (Christmas Day), December 30, 2021 (Rizal Day), and January 1, 2022 (New Year’s Day) with the regular weekends/holiday schedule.

Note that the Roosevelt Station will remain temporarily closed until further notice to give way to the ongoing construction of the Unified Grand Central Station (UGCS), connecting the LRT-1, MRT-3, and MRT-7.
